Miss Layton does not indulge in details, but that is the impression I gather from her letters." Hume paused, and Brett shot a quick glance at him.
"Finish what you were going to say," he said.
"Only this--Helen and I have mutually released each other from our engagement, and in the same breath have refused to be released.

That is, if you understand--" The barrister nodded.
"The result is that we are both thoroughly miserable.

Our respective fathers do not like the idea of our marriage under the circumstances.

We are simply drifting in the feeble hope that some day a kindly Providence will dissipate the cloud that hangs over me.

Ah, Mr.Brett, I am a rich man.
